JAKE HESS, GONE HOME TO BE WITH THE LORD |
| |
Sunday
morning , January the 4th Jake Hess finally lost his long
struggle with multiple health problems. Jake was 76 years
of age. I met Jake in the early 70's and he became a great
friend and my mentor since then. I like thousands more,
was saddened by the news. Jake was, both a fine man, a
devoted father, a great lead singer, and most of all,
a tremendous witness for Christ. He and I, along with
our families, attended the same church in Nashville for
many years, and sang together there on occasion. Mike
Meyer, Woody Beatty and myself drove to the funeral home
in Columbus, GA the night before the funeral and then
attended his funeral at Jake's home church the next day.
Many great memories of Jake flooded my mind this week.
Jake was the most imitated lead singer ever in Southern
Gospel Music. I will miss him. But I am very sure the
Statesmen sound better today than ever. Jake you were
Nuthin' But Fine. |
